Proposal

Lawson cypress hedge to remove to ground level, grind out stumps to approximately 200mm below existing ground level. The hedge has been severely cut back one side and is now subsiding and declining. 1 x Cherry plum to remove in sections to ground level. Tree is declining and there is a large decaying cavity on trunk. The Cherry has reached its potential lifespan. 1 x Ash to remove in sections to below hedge height using specialist rigging techniques to lower branches in a safe manner. Tree is located in close proximity between 2 properties. Historic pruning has created proliferation of growth exacerbating issues of light and issues to neighbouring property. The tree is a nuisance with overhanging branches with debris and bird poo on cars and driveway 1 x Poplar to remove in sections to ground level. Half of the tree is dead the other half compromised by the large dying cavity
